Sheikh Ibn Uthaymeen, may Allah have mercy on him, said:
The correct view is that it is permissible to sell the Mushaf and it is valid based on the principle, which is permissibility. Muslims have continued to do so until today. If we had prohibited its sale, it would have prevented people from benefiting from it, because most people are stingy about giving it to others. If they have some piety and give it, they give it reluctantly. If we told everyone that if you are not in need of the Mushaf, you must give it to others, it would be difficult for many people.
And he, may Allah have mercy on him, said:
Selling and buying the Mushaf is permissible and there is no harm in it. Muslims have continued to buy and sell Mushafs without objection. The Mushaf cannot spread among people except by permitting its sale and purchase or by lending it to those who do not need it, as mentioned by some scholars.
